Why Your Children Must Eat Seafood! 5 Benefits You Should Know

 

Children may not like seafood in its plain form, but that should not discourage you from making them try different varieties of seafood, including fish, prawns, and crabs.

Seafood contains loads of vitamins and nutrients essential for a child's growth. Here is why you must encourage children to eat seafood:

1. Good Source of Nutrients

Seafood is high in protein and contains loads of vital nutrients, such as vitamins A and B and omega-3 fatty acids. All these vitamins help children become stronger and healthier. They boost brain function, as well as the eyes and immune system.

Since the human body cannot produce too much omega-3 on its own, you must ensure that your children eat seafood and make it a part of their everyday diet.

2. Boosts Eyesight

Even though children have better eyesight than older individuals, it is vital to protect their eyes from a young age. After all, eyesight weakening with age is a common transition most people go through.

However, taking care of your eyesight at a young age can make you healthier in the long run. Hence, children must eat seafood since the vitamin A in seafood helps boost eye health, ensuring that they will grow up healthy individuals who do not suffer from weak eyesight.

3. Increases Brain Function

Since children's brains are always developing, you need to give them a boost by ensuring good brain health. One way to do this is by including seafood in their regular diet. The omega-3 present in seafood also prevents individuals from developing Alzheimer's at a young age and ensures that their mental health does not decline as they age.

The nutrients present in seafood can also help children's bodies regulate emotion and memory- two of the most critical parts of a child's growth process.

4. Boosts Heart Health

All kinds of seafood at high in omega-3 fatty acids that help boost heart health and prevent heart diseases in the long run. Giving your children fish and crabs twice a week can help them grow into healthy individuals who will not suffer from strokes and heart attacks in the long run.

5. Ensures Healthy Hair and Skin

Children are usually prone to developing dry skin, but the great thing about seafood is it protects and boosts skin moisture. The fish oil and omega-3 in seafood help reduce the likelihood of developing acne and protect children's skin against ultraviolet rays, leaving it supple and moisturized.

This is extremely important as when children hit puberty; they start developing loads of acne. Moreover, since they go to school, it can be hard to keep them protected from harsh sun rays.

Moreover, the omega-3 in seafood helps boost hair growth, leaving it shiny and long.
